Hey! The fee for B.Sc. B.Ed. depends on the college. Government colleges usually charge around 10,000–30,000 per year, while private colleges can charge 50,000 to 1.5 lakh per year. Total fees for the full course can range from 40,000 to 6 lakh. Hostel and mess charges may be extra. It’s best to check the specific college’s website for exact fees.

The BSC nursing is a 4 years course with fees ranging from INR 10,000 - 50,000 per year in a government collage and INR 1,00,000 - 3,00,000 annual in a private collage. To join, BSC nursing course you need to complete your 12th with PCB and must score a minimum of 45-50%. You then need to pass an entrance exam like NEET UG. Your age should be at least 17. After the course you can look for career opportunities as Staff Nurse, Registered Nurse, Administrator in h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are settings.

You need to complete 12th with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ology with at least 45 marks.
Some colleges require entrance exams like NEET or state-level tests.
Government college fees range from 25,000 to 50,000 per year.
Private college fees can be between 1,00,000 to 3,00,000 annually.
After a BSc in Nursing, job opportunities include staff nurse, nursing officer, and educator roles.
You can also work abroad or pursue higher studies like MSc Nursing for specialization.
